In Anno 1404 , the term "map" refers to the randomized output of a seed generator influenced by player-defined parameters. Unlike static maps in traditional RTS games, an Anno map is defined by its archipelago structure. A "bad" map is characterized by islands with insufficient building space, disjointed fertilities that prevent self-sufficient production chains, or strategic bottlenecks that cripple trade logistics. Conversely, a "best" map optimizes space, resources, and defensibility.
